About Gray Media:

Gray Media or Gray is a multimedia company headquartered in Atlanta Georgia formally known as Gray Television Inc. The company is the nations largest owner of top-rated local television stations and digital assets serving 113 television markets that collectively reach approximately 36 percent of US television households. The portfolio includes 77 markets with the top-rated television station and 100 markets with the first and/or second-highest-rated television station as well as the largest Telemundo Affiliate group with 43 markets totaling nearly 1.5 million Hispanic TV Households. The company also owns Gray Digital Media a full-service digital agency offering national and local clients digital marketing strategies with the most advanced digital products and services. Grays additional media properties include video production companies Raycom Sports Tupelo Media Group and PowerNation Studios and studio production facilities Assembly Atlanta and Third Rail Studios.

About WKYT:

WKYT-TV is home to the CBS and CW affiliates in beautiful Lexington KY. The station sits amongst picturesque horse farms in the Thoroughbred Capital of the World.

The Lexington DMA (#63) provides a competitive news environment and WKYT has emerged as the news leader producing over 65 hours of news per week. Our team of award-winning professionals thrives in a fast-paced yet fun environment.

Job Summary/Description:

WKYT and WYMT are searching for a digital news leader and innovator to grow audience and direct creation of local news content across digital mobile app OTT and social media platforms. We are looking for a talented and experienced Digital Content Manager to join our team focused on transforming our stations brands into 24/7 digital news operations.

The Digital Content Manager works with other newsroom leaders in WKYT in Lexington and WYMT in Hazard to oversee daily news editorial decisions while also setting strategic goals for the newsrooms. This includes managing breaking news coverage special project content franchise support and developing a strategy for and as well as our mobile apps social media SEO OTT/streaming push alerts voice platforms and more. This person will play a key role in charting the stations news audience growth strategies. We are looking for a people-focused leader with experience in digital journalism accountable for growing audiences on multiple platforms while focusing on creating quality impactful and informative news content. You will use your exceptional journalism ethics while serving as a member of the newsrooms management teams and coaching teams to create engaging and compelling local news content. Analyzing data and disseminating information to the entire newsroom rounds out this role always providing the context needed to understand the metrics. This role requires chief editorial digital leadership in the newsroom a creative storyteller with a strong understanding of digital marketing SEO best practices analytics and video production for digital and social media. The ideal candidate will be passionate about creating engaging content that resonates with our target audiences and drives business objectives ensuring our digital presence is as strong and engaging as our on-air product.
